Abstract

The invention discloses a numerical control tool rest feeding structure of a vertical lathe. The structure of the numerical control tool rest feeding structure comprises a cable, a control key box, aworktable, a lathe body, a power cord, an engine, a voltage adjusting valve, a side tool rest, speed adjusting valves, a crossbeam, an upright post, a belt, a lifting motor and a tool rest feeding structure body; the cable is connected with the control key box; the worktable is fixedly connected with the lathe body; the tool rest feeding structure body consists of a control handle, a damping wheel, a rail, a sliding plate, a vertical tool rest and a positioner; the control handle is connected with the damping wheel; the rail is provided with the sliding plate; the vertical tool rest is arranged on the sliding plate; and the positioner is supplied with power by the lifting motor connected with the cable. By being provided with the tool rest feeding structure body, the numerical control tool rest feeding structure disclosed by the invention can be slowed down and buffered at a place which has a certain distance from an object, thereby preventing occurrences of noises, damages and accidents caused by collision and prolonging the service life.

Description

technical field [0001] The invention relates to a feeding structure of a numerically controlled tool holder for a vertical lathe, which belongs to the field of vertical lathes. Background technique [0002] Vertical lathes are used to process workpieces that are relatively large in diameter and weight, or that are difficult to install on a horizontal lathe. The axis of the spindle is perpendicular to the horizontal plane, and the workpiece is installed on a horizontal rotary table. The main movement is driven by the table. , the feed movement is realized by the vertical tool holder and the side tool holder.
